Sharepoint to local server migration

Good afternoon! I am currently needing to clear up Sharepoint space, but luckily have server hardware running for a project that ended up being abandoned. I am looking for some information on the best practices for getting the server set up to host a lot of this data as an archive to get it moved off the Sharepoint site and avoid having to spend more for more cloud storage. 

I'm also sick of getting an email every day that I'm out of space. 

 

So, essentially, I was hoping to get some guidance on the local server setup, and any information/tips for pulling the data down from Sharepoint (the current plan for pulling the data is going to be download a chuck, verify data integrity on the server, then remove from Sharepoint. But that's going to be a long process for multiple TBs of data, so if there's a better way please let me know).

My plan is also to get a license for the Sharepoint local front end for the archive server, but will probably wait to see how much the old data is even used before I spend money on that.
